Hans Stringer, a seasoned mixed martial artist, has amassed an impressive record of 22 wins, 8 losses, and 3 draws throughout his career. Competing primarily in the Light Heavyweight division with a weight of 205 lbs., he stands tall at 6' 3" and holds an orthodox stance. In terms of performance, Stringer demonstrated a striking accuracy of 61%, landing an average of 3.16 significant strikes per minute during his UFC career. However, he also absorbed an average of 2.84 strikes per minute, with a strike defense rate of 41%. He averaged 2.4 takedowns per 15 minutes and maintained a takedown accuracy of 36%, but did not attempt any submissions during the same period. Stringer's career highlights include a significant victory over Francimar Barroso, who held an ELO rating of 1015 at the time. His most recent fights saw him achieve a win against Barroso in March 2014 via Split Decision (S-DEC), followed by two consecutive losses to Fabio Maldonado and Ilir Latifi, both ending in knockout/technical knockout (KO/TKO) punches. His last recorded fight was in July 2015.
